Embodiment 1

[0036] The present embodiment provides a kind of herbicide (granule), is made up of the composition of following parts by weight:

[0037]

[0038] The preparation method of described herbicide comprises the steps:

[0039] (1) Dilute the binder with 5 times the mass of water and mix it with the carrier, then add metolachlor to obtain mixed granules;

[0040] (2) Spray evenly the xylene solution in which oxyfluorfen is dissolved on the surface of the mixed particles, place in a ventilated and cool place, and wait for the xylene to volatilize to obtain the product.

Abstract

The invention relates to the technical field of weeding, in particular to a herbicide composition and a herbicide and a preparation method and application thereof. The herbicide composition comprisesthe following effective components: metolachlor and oxyfluorfen, wherein the mass ratio of the metolachlor to the oxyfluorfen is (5-10): (1-10). The herbicide comprises the herbicide composition, preferably, the dosage form of the herbicide is granules. The two effective components (metolachlor and oxyfluorfen) of the herbicide composition are in synergistic interaction so that the herbicide composition has the effects of environmental protection and safety, particularly has the effects of high efficiency and wide herbicide controlling spectrum and exceeds the use of two single-dose varieties,namely metolachlor and oxyfluorfen. The herbicide composition is safe to crops, low in cost and good in control effect. The herbicide avoids damage of herbicide spray to leaves and effectively prevents and removes gramineous weeds and broadleaf weeds. The herbicide is simple and convenient to weed, labor-saving and time-saving.
